How to Choose a Bunk Bed in My Area

A bunk bed is a great option when you are limited in space or if two children share the same space. It's important to pick the correct bed to ensure that your child, as well as anyone who sleeps in that bedroom will have a comfortable sleep.

When you're choosing a bunkbed there are numerous aspects to take into account. These include the design and safety features. Whether you buy online or in a store it is important to do your homework.

Mattresses

The mattress you select for your bunk bed are an important element in the safety and comfort of your child. Apart from the size of the mattress, you should also consider the material type and the firmness. You should also consider your child's age, body type, and the position of sleep.

The most suitable bunk beds for children come with a sturdy guardrail to stop falls from the top bunk. It is also important to check the height and weight limits of the mattress you are planning to buy. You should choose the mattress that will fit the dimensions of the bunk bed frame you are purchasing.

childrens bunk beds  are available in different sizes that can be adapted to different frames or styles of beds. These include trundle-size and twin XL options. These are great for children who don't require a large bed yet, or for use as an extra bed during sleepovers.

You can pick from a wide range of bunk bed mattresses including innerspring, foam, and hybrid. Hybrid mattresses incorporate memory foam with innerspring to create a comfortable sleeping surface.

These models are usually cooler than memory foam mattresses and can include cooling infusions such graphite or gel. If your child, or house guest tends to get hot while they sleep, this could be an a good option for them.

Configurations

Bunk beds come in a variety of styles and can serve as the perfect solution for any bedroom. They are great for shared rooms such as youth hostels, ships and military barracks. They can also be used in homes with limited space or to save money by not having to purchase extra furniture.

One of the most favored bunk bed styles is a twin over twin bunk bed, which is comprised of two twin-sized beds stacked together. It is an affordable and visually appealing arrangement for sleeping, particularly if your kids are in the same age group.

Another type of bunk bed is an L-shaped arrangement. This type of bed allows you to make more use of the space and also make it easier to get access to the top bunk.

The L-shaped arrangement is particularly useful when there is a lot of floor space available but there isn't much ceiling height in the room. This setup is ideal for kids who enjoy playing games and reading in their bedrooms, or want to be able to share their space with their friends.

Think about an L-shaped loft that has an under-bed desk if your child is an undergraduate. This design can fit in the space of a full or twin bed and includes side and front loaded drawers to store things.

Some L-shaped beds have the option of a pull-out trundle that can be expanded into a full size bed if needed. Trundle mattresses are typically stored in a drawer underneath the bunk bed. They can be purchased separately.

Safety

A bunk bed is a great way to save space in your home However, it can also pose certain risks that you need to know about. There are many ways to ensure your children are safe in their bunk beds.

First, ensure that you have a conversation with your child about bunk bed safety. This will help them develop an logical and healthy method of using their new bed, and will help you avoid injuries from occurring in the future.

Another important part of bunk bed safety is making sure that your child is not allowed to play or jump on the top bunk. This is because jumping on beds can result in serious injury such as head injuries.


Also, do not let your children hang their personal items on the rails or posts of their bunk bed including jewelry, belts or skipping ropes, or anything that could result in strangulation if they are caught. Keep them in a secure space, like a closet.

The bunk bed should be positioned in the corner of the room so that the walls meet two sides. It's recommended to place it in a way that it's at least just a few feet from the ceiling fan, lights or other objects that could be a danger for your child.

You can also install guardrails on the top bunk. They should be five inches above the mattress. The doorway for entry should not be more than 15 inches wide, and the gap between the guardrails must not be greater than 3.5 inches.

In addition to these safety measures It is also important to think about the weight limit of the bunk bed, and make sure that only one person is permitted to sleep on the top bunk at any time. If you have more than one person in the top bunk the bed is more prone to collapse. This can be dangerous for your kids.
